Senior Planning Consultant with a team of 8 planners for the NMOQ New Museum of Qatar ($435 Million facility) during the Engineering, Procurement Construction and Commissioning phases covering all Earthworks, Civils, Structural, Mechanical, Piping, Electrical, Instrumentation and Scada works. Responsibilities includes developing of master schedule, critical path analysis and impact of progress and scope changes on previously scheduled target dates, delay Analysis and Forensic Planning.

  • TIA/ (Time Impact Analysis) Claims
  • Identifying delaying events.
  • Co-ordinating events with construction, sub-contract admin teams.
  • Data gathering.
  • TIA Delay Analysis and preparing of narrative & TIA.
  • Prep & submit delay notices in accordance with the Contract.
  • Maintain delay register.
  • Prep disruption and acceleration claims in conjunction with Cost Manager and Team.
  • Co-ordinate with Commercial team.
  • Attend delay / claim meetings with team
